Does a bathroom remodel add value to a home?

Yes, a well-executed bathroom remodel can significantly add value to a home. Bathrooms, along with kitchens, are among the most important rooms for potential homebuyers, and updated, modern bathrooms can be a major selling point. According to industry experts and real estate professionals, a bathroom renovation can recoup anywhere from 50% to 70% of the project's cost in increased home value.

Factors that contribute to increased value include:

  • Updated fixtures, cabinets, and countertops
  • Improved functionality and efficient layout
  • Enhanced lighting, ventilation, and storage
  • Integration of energy-efficient features
  • Use of high-quality, durable materials
However, it's crucial to avoid overspending on luxury features that may not align with your neighborhood's home values. A well-planned and executed bathroom remodel may not only improve your daily living experience but also boost your home's resale value and appeal to potential buyers.

What are the steps in a bathroom remodel project?

A successful bathroom remodel project generally follows a series of steps to ensure a smooth and organized process. Here are the typical steps involved:
  1. Planning and design: Determine your goals, budget, and desired features, and work with a designer or contractor to create a detailed plan.
  2. Obtaining permits: Apply for and secure any necessary permits from your local building department.
  3. Demolition: Remove existing fixtures, tiles, cabinets, and any structural elements that need to be replaced.
  4. Rough-in work: Address any necessary plumbing, electrical, or HVAC work, as well as any structural modifications.
  5. Installation: Install new fixtures, cabinets, countertops, tile work, and any other elements specified in your design plan.
  6. Finishing touches: Complete any final touches, such as painting, installing hardware, and cleaning up the work area.
  7. Inspection and approval: Schedule any required inspections and obtain final approval from the building department.
Each step requires careful coordination and communication with your contractors and tradespeople to ensure the project stays on schedule and adheres to all building codes and regulations. Proper planning and attention to detail are essential for a successful bathroom renovation.

What should I consider when remodeling a small bathroom?

Remodeling a small bathroom can present unique challenges, but with proper planning and design strategies, you may achieve a functional and visually appealing space. Here are some key considerations:
  • Layout optimization: Explore space-saving layouts, such as corner sinks, pedestal sinks, or wall-mounted toilets.
  • Lighting: Incorporate strategically placed lighting, such as recessed lights or wall sconces, to make the space appear larger and brighter.
  • Color and materials: Use light colors and reflective surfaces to create a sense of openness and maximize natural light.
  • Storage solutions: Maximize storage with built-in shelving, niches, or cabinets with sliding doors or drawers.
  • Fixtures and fittings: Choose compact or wall-mounted fixtures, such as toilets, sinks, and showers, to save floor space.
  • Mirrors: Strategically place mirrors to create the illusion of depth and reflect light, making the space feel larger.
Working with an experienced bathroom designer or contractor may assist you maximize the potential of your small bathroom and incorporate creative solutions that balance functionality, aesthetics, and efficient use of space.
